Running the car without coolant pressure...92-960-6L 900 1992

I started having coolant leak two months ago with no exterior visible leak at all, after a lot of testing and hoses / clamps replacements I had to think it must be a minor leak inside one of the pistons combustion chamber.
I decided to try with an old coolant reservoir cap after removing the pressure valve so the car would run with no pressure, but kept a good 75 Kpa black cap on the car just in case. Well, no leaks at all after that, no overheating, no boiling, everything perfect but it's never higher than 80 degrees F outside now in Miami so probably it'll be different when in summer we get to 100F.
I am afraid this can be dangerous at some point to the cooling system...any ideas, thoughts about this no pressure test?
